Use header tags to structure your page

HTML header tags help Google understand the content on your pages, and break it up into logical, easily skimmed sections.

Header tags look like this—<h2>Header goes here</h2>—in your page’s code. You can use the Ahrefs toolbar to quickly see how header tags are used on a page:

As a general guide, try to:

  • Use one <h1> tag per page.
  • Use <h2> tags for your page’s main points. 
  • Use <h3> tags (and beyond) for sections that support your main points, like examples or related ideas.

As an added benefit, good use of subheadings will improve the readability of your content, making it easier to see, at a glance, what each section is about:
